Why does Copilot Cowork cost more on some CRM tasks than others?

Table of Contents

The Direct Answer

Cowork costs vary because every task is priced on four factors: the model used, context retrieved, tool and connector calls, and runtime. A task that scans hundreds of opportunities across several connectors runs long and costs more; a single-record lookup on one connector is short and cheap. Scope and complexity, not the tool, drive the difference.

Deeper Explanation

The cost of a task is built up from its work, not fixed by its type. Cowork draws Copilot Credits at $0.01 each, and Microsoft is explicit that a task’s total depends on four levers: model selection, context retrieval through Work IQ, the number of tool calls, and runtime duration. A CRM task that touches many records, pulls context from Dynamics plus mailbox plus documents, and runs for minutes accumulates cost on all four levers at once. A quick “what’s this deal’s close date” hits one record, one connector, and finishes fast — so it barely registers.

That is why two tasks that look similar can bill very differently. A full at-risk pipeline sweep and a single-opportunity check are both “CRM tasks,” but the sweep sits in the heavy tier and the check in the light tier because their scope and runtime differ by an order of magnitude. Reading a pipeline view for one segment is cheap; asking the agent to reason across the whole org is not. Recognizing which lever a task pulls hardest — usually context breadth and runtime — is the key to predicting and controlling its cost before you run it.

The four levers also interact, which is why cost can surprise even careful users. A broad context scope doesn’t just add its own charge — it lengthens runtime and can trigger more tool calls, so a single loose setting cascades across three of the four factors at once. That coupling is why the biggest savings usually come from tightening scope first: narrowing the data the task sees tends to shorten runtime and reduce retrieval together, giving a larger cost cut than swapping the model alone would.

It helps to think in tiers rather than exact numbers. Microsoft groups tasks roughly into light, medium, and heavy bands, and most CRM work falls predictably into one: a field lookup is light, a segment summary is medium, a full-pipeline reasoning task is heavy. You rarely need to predict credits to the digit — you need to know which band a task lands in and whether that band is justified. Building that tier intuition across a team prevents the routine reclassification of cheap work into the expensive band by accident.

Predicting cost gets easier once a team shares a simple mental model: scope drives context, context and complexity drive runtime, and runtime plus model drive the bill. Reps who internalize that chain stop being surprised, because they can feel before running a task which levers it pulls. That intuition is cheaper to build than it sounds — a few labeled examples of light, medium, and heavy CRM tasks give most sellers a reliable sense of where a new task will land.

The corollary is that the same words can hide very different costs. ‘Analyze my pipeline’ can be a light segment summary or a heavy org-wide reasoning task depending entirely on scope. Teaching reps to make the scope explicit — which segment, which fields, which timeframe — removes the ambiguity that lets a routine-sounding request quietly become an expensive run.

Strategy and Actionable Steps

Predict and control task cost before you run it:

  1. Read the four levers. Before running a task, ask which model, how much context, how many connectors, and how long — that estimates the tier.
  2. Narrow the scope. Point tasks at a saved CRM segment instead of the whole org to cut context retrieval and runtime.
  3. Trim the connectors. Enable only the connector the task needs so Work IQ isn’t retrieving and billing for unrelated context.
  4. Right-size the model. Use a lighter model for routine CRM work; reserve the flagship for genuinely complex reasoning.
  5. Watch the meters. Compare real consumption meters against your estimate so your tier intuition improves over time.
  6. Cap the outliers. Set limits and alerts so an unexpectedly heavy task surfaces before it lands on the invoice.

FAQ

What are the four factors that set a task’s cost?

Model selection, context retrieval through Work IQ, the number of tool and connector calls, and runtime duration. Every task’s credit total is built from these four, so a task that maximizes all four costs far more than one that touches a single record briefly.

Why does an at-risk sweep cost more than a deal lookup?

Scope and runtime. A sweep reasons across hundreds of records and often several connectors over minutes; a lookup hits one record on one connector and finishes fast. Same category of work, very different draw on the cost levers.

Does the model choice alone explain the cost gap?

No. Model matters, but context breadth, connector calls, and runtime often matter more. A lighter model on a huge, unscoped task can still cost more than a flagship model on a tight one, so all four levers deserve attention.

Can I predict a task’s cost before running it?

Roughly, yes. Estimate the four levers — model, context breadth, connector count, expected runtime — to place a task in the light, medium, or heavy tier. Comparing your estimate to the actual meter sharpens that intuition quickly.

Why do enabled connectors raise cost even when unused?

Because Work IQ may retrieve context from any enabled connector to answer a task, and that retrieval is billed. Leaving every connector on for a CRM task invites retrieval you never needed, inflating context cost for no benefit.

How do I stop a task from costing more than expected?

Scope it tightly, trim connectors, right-size the model, and set spending limits with alerts. Together these control all four cost levers and ensure an unexpectedly heavy run is caught before it reaches the invoice.

Does running the same CRM task twice cost the same each time?

Roughly, if scope and model are unchanged, but not exactly. Runtime and how much context Work IQ retrieves can vary with the data and load, so identical prompts can differ modestly in credits. Large swings usually mean the scope or connectors changed, not random variation.
